In uncooked meats, it will not be the presence of pathogens that dictate shelf-life. 2.3 Measures of shelf-life In fresh meats that are stored in air, pseudomonads will dominate the total population of bacteria so a standard plate count is a good guide to the onset of spoilage.

Webraw beef, poultry, fish and seafood in the refrigerator. Place raw meats on the bottom shelf of the refrigerator in a tray or pan. This will prevent blood or juices from drip-ping onto fresh produce. • Do not place heavy items on top of fruits and vegetables. •Keep the temperature of your refrigerator at 40 degrees F or below. Hamburger. Hot Dogs. photo of ancient romeWebDec 28, 2024 · Freeze at 0°F (-18°C). To retain vitamin content, color, flavor, and texture, freeze items at peak freshness and store at 0°F or lower. Food stored constantly at 0°F will always be safe to thaw and eat; only quality suffers with lengthy freezer storage.
